#b2e589 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b2e589 is composed of 69.8% red, 89.8% green and 53.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 22.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 40.2% yellow and 10.2% black. It has a hue angle of 93.3 degrees, a saturation of 63.9% and a lightness of 71.8%. #b2e589 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#65cb13. Closest websafe color is: #99cc99.

#b2e589 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b2e589 has RGB values of R:178, G:229, B:137 and CMYK values of C:0.22, M:0, Y:0.4, K:0.1. Its decimal value is 11724169.

Shades and Tints of #b2e589
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060b02 is the darkest color, while #fbfefa is the lightest one.

Tones of #b2e589
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b7b9b5 is the less saturated color, while #b0fb73 is the most saturated one.
